As I headed back across the Bay from San Francisco to Alameda after a day in the city, the sun was starting to set on a November day. As the ferry headed under the San Francisco – Oakland Bay Bridge, I was able to quickly capture the light hitting the western section of the bridge. The ferry to Bay Farm Island quickly made its way under the bridge but not before I was to capture the scene from the boat. For this image I felt just showing the limited section of the bridge helped tell the story with the negative space allowing the viewer to wonder where the bridge is leading and complete the story.
